Output 01bb2bf32b69730c21075c3d5c68d8f85db4c0dc51a5e4cbda07cd62ec79ec77:1

value
2789839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81da66f2c4c5ed476e9c39ad9c742e59f7ac28d4 OP_EQUAL
address
3DXcj8tCjfDNDjBF48cYswdLRfqEVquWf6
transaction
01bb2bf32b69730c21075c3d5c68d8f85db4c0dc51a5e4cbda07cd62ec79ec77
spent
true